Found solution to pixelsearch and pixelgetcolor being slow in windows 7, 8 and 10

Posted: 22 Jul 2016, 16:35
by leosouza85
I was suffering with pixelsearch and pixelgetcolor being very very slow in windows 7 and 10. So I did some research, tests and benchmarks and found that the cause is windows desktop theme effects...

Performance improves in the same script from 1300 ms to 15 ms


Solution for Windows Vista. and 7
Open the script in compatibility mode with windows XP. Or use windows classic theme.

Windows 8 and 10:

Since is not possible to use windows classic theme if you install the classic shell app and use classic style you are good to go.
